Steve Aldo One (born 5 January 1995) is a Cameroonian footballer who plays as a central defender.
Born in Yaoundé, One moved to Spain at the age of ten and represented RCD Mallorca as a youth. [1] He made his senior debut with the reserves on 16 December 2012, starting in a 0–1 Segunda División B away loss against UE Sant Andreu.
One scored his first senior goal on 12 October 2014, netting his team's third in a 4–2 away defeat of Real Zaragoza B. [2] In February 2016, he suffered a severe knee injury which took him out for seven months. [3]
On 7 July 2017, One moved to another reserve team, Deportivo Fabril also in the third division. [4] He made his first team debut on 29 November, starting in a 3–2 win at UD Las Palmas for the season's Copa del Rey. [5]
One made his La Liga debut on 21 January 2018, starting in a 1–7 away loss against Real Madrid.
